No Need to See You Again Chapter 1

I've been in a five-year secret relationship with Shawn Lowell. For so long, everyone thinks we're rivals who hate each other's guts.

At a bachelorette party hosted by a mutual friend, the bride-to-be orders every guy who is still single to wear eye masks. After that, every single woman has to walk one lap in front of them.

This is so that the men can pick up on the women's perfumes. If they find a perfume they like the most, they can embrace the woman instantly and become a couple for the day.

I walk very slowly in front of the men on purpose. In fact, I even stop in front of Shawn for half a second.

But as soon as Shawn takes off his eye mask, he finds himself hugging Alyssa Sutton, his childhood sweetheart and first love.

"Wow! You really are amazing, Mr. Lowell! You actually recognized Alyssa from all those fragrances and hugged her on the spot! Even God thinks you two are a match made in heaven!"

Alyssa's eyes slightly redden, whereas Shawn looks down at her with a doting smile playing on his lips. Both of them refuse to let go of each other.

As I stand a short distance away, I just smile at the scene.

Last night, Shawn was still kissing the scar on my chest in bed while telling me that he wanted to marry me.

How is it that he's forgotten his promise in just the blink of an eye?

Jocelyn's POV

Someone from the crowd teased, "Shawn, it's like heaven's smiling on you two, letting you and Alyssa be a couple for the day to make up for the lost time."

Another chimed in, "Exactly. Shawn has everything going for him, yet we haven't heard a word about his love life in years. It really makes you wonder if he's been hung up on someone this whole time."

The crowd's eyes darted back and forth between my secret boyfriend, Shawn Lowell, and his childhood sweetheart, Alyssa Sutton, their expressions heavy with implication.

Alyssa's ears flushed pink under everyone's gaze. She gave Shawn a playful shove, but he just stood there with a faint smile on his lips, neither confirming nor denying anything.

He played it off. "That's enough, guys. It's all in the past."

Then, as if to justify himself, he added, "I couldn't really catch anyone else's scent. I chose Alyssa because of her jasmine scent. It's the same one she wore back in school. Besides, if I'd grabbed the wrong woman by mistake, it would've been mortifying for her. I've still got a shred of decency left."

The room erupted in whistles and laughter, the suggestion hanging in the air.

I laughed along, easy and practiced, though my jaw ached from holding the smile.

I couldn't put a name to what I was feeling. It was a suffocating mix of bitterness and a sharp, aching tightness.

Before we left this morning, we had used the same bottle of body wash.

It was the oud scent Shawn had been loyal to for five years.

I'd once told him it was too heavy and that I wanted to switch, but he'd looked at me with those puppy-dog eyes.

He said he was a creature of habit and that only things that never changed made him feel secure.

"Like you," he'd said.

I'd let that one line get to my head. I'd bought two whole cases at once—enough to last eight years.

And yet here I was, standing right in front of him, carrying that exact same scent.

How could he possibly not recognize it?

"Wait… Jocelyn, why do I feel like you and Shawn smell the same?" the bride-to-be, Kristine Tanner, asked me as she brushed past me.

Her words sent a sudden hush over the room.

Everyone there knew Shawn and me were like oil and water. For five years, we'd been at each other's throats, poaching each other's deals, clawing to bring the other one down.

But Shawn had pulled through those five years. He'd dragged Lowell Group back from the brink of bankruptcy and fought his way up until he stood level with me.

So… had the whole thing been an act?

Probing gazes began to shift toward me.

Shawn cleared his throat right on cue, his voice dismissive as he tried to cover up. "It's just some generic body wash. It's hardly surprising we'd smell the same."

He hated artificial fragrances. That was why he'd never once bought me perfume. Our home only ever smelled like soap and laundry detergent.

He claimed that if there were too many scents around him, he'd have nightmares.

In the stillness of the night, he'd pull me beneath him and lose himself in me, desperate to coat every inch of me in his scent. He wanted me to belong to him and only him forever.

His eyes would go bloodshot, and he'd hold me so tight that I could barely breathe. Last night had been no different.

And yet now, he was dismissing me as "generic".

I shot back, "You're right. I'll switch brands the second I get home."

The scar on my chest throbbed with a dull ache. I reached up, brushed my fingers over it, and smiled. "I'd hate to keep sharing a scent with a stray. It'll only bring me bad luck."

"Jocelyn, what did you just say?" Shawn snapped, and the atmosphere in the room plunged to ice.

His brow furrowed as he pinned me with a glare. He'd always hated it when I tried to draw a line between us.

But today, Shawn had no grounds to lash out at me. All he could do was stare daggers at me.

I was speechless at his audacity. Was I the one who'd asked him to hold another woman in his arms?

I let out a cold laugh. Just as I was about to snap back, Kristine rushed in to smooth things over, terrified we were about to blow up her pre-wedding party.

"Oh, come on, Josie. It's my big day. Do me a favor and don't let him get under your skin."

She tried to change the subject. "So, has anyone caught your eye yet? I know you have high standards, but if you're still single, I'd love to set you up with someone."

"I do, actually," I said casually.

I glanced around the room, my eyes flickering toward a figure in the corner before landing back on Shawn. Then I dropped the bombshell, smiling as I spoke. "I'm getting engaged this weekend."
